GRAVESEND Ladies Hockey Club made a winning start to 2012 with a 3-1 success at Ashford’s second string on Saturday.
It was their first game since the Christmas break and despite the lack of recent action, Gravesend started strongly and were soon on the score sheet when Odette Kelham fired the first penalty corner of the game beyond the reach of the Ashford keeper.
Karen Jones saw an opening and slotted a pass in behind the Ashford defence, allowing Hayley Stringer to dart in and tip a shot home to double the advantage.
Gravesend then seemed to lack some concentration and Ashford were able to pull a goal back when they were awarded a penalty corner which they converted it.
The second half continued to be very competitive but it was Gravesend who were on the score sheet again, mid way through, when Di Prior, having injected a penalty corner, ran into the post to strike into the goal.
